PRESTO P4 LEVEL LOADER OWNER’S MANUAL 5

3. During shipping, the platform of the unit is

raised 5-1/2", and this platform is supported
on two pins. This allows a space under the
platform. When you want to move the unit,
put a pallet jack under the platform and lift
the unit. This is the best way of moving the
unit.

CAUTION!

Always raise the platform and insert
the pins before you move the unit. If
you try to move the unit in another
way, the frame may be bent. Be sure
to remove the pins before you
operate the unit. If you do not do
this, the unit may be damaged. Once
the unit has power, raise the platform
just a bit to take the load off of the
pins, then remove the pins.

4. The unit has an 10' power cord. Choose a

location where the cord can reach an outlet
easily, without stretching the cord tightly.

5. Move the unit into position, supporting the

platform of the unit. Place the unit on a firm,
level surface.

CAUTION!

If you place the unit on a surface
which is not firm or level, the
unit may shift as it operates. You
may be hurt, or the unit or load
may be damaged.

6. The unit may be operated without bolting
the frame to the floor. However, the
mounting arrangement is more secure if
you use lag screws. Bolt the unit to the
floor using four lag bolts. These should run
through the lag angles at the corners of
the base frame. Insert and tighten the lag
bolts to secure the unit. Grout under the
base rails to prevent vibration and distortion
of the base frame.
